Quick answer: Many military families stationed at Marine Corps Base Hawaii Kaneohe consider Kaneohe, Kailua, Hawaii Kai, Aiea, and Ewa Beach. Each offers a different mix of commute, housing style, and daily lifestyle.
The right choice depends on your budget, commute tolerance, family needs, and whether you prefer Windward living, town access, or more space in West Oahu.
| Community | Why Families Consider It | Housing Feel |
|---|---|---|
| Kaneohe | Close access to Marine Corps Base Hawaii and Windward Oahu | Single-family homes, townhomes, condos, and established neighborhoods |
| Kailua | Beach lifestyle, local shops, and Windward living | Single-family homes, cottages, townhomes, and select luxury properties |
| Hawaii Kai | East Oahu location with marina, ocean, and town access | Condos, townhomes, single-family homes, and luxury homes |
| Aiea | Central access to multiple parts of Oahu | Homes, townhomes, and condos with practical commute options |
| Ewa Beach | West Oahu housing variety and newer communities | Single-family homes, townhomes, and planned communities |
Families stationed at MCBH Kaneohe often start by looking at Kaneohe and Kailua because of their Windward location and access to base. These areas can make daily life feel simpler for families who want to stay closer to Kaneohe Bay.
Hawaii Kai is a different option. It offers East Oahu living with ocean, marina, and town access. Aiea gives families a more central position on the island. Ewa Beach may appeal to buyers who want more housing variety or newer West Oahu communities.
The point is not that one area is better than another. The decision comes down to commute, housing style, budget, and the kind of daily routine that fits your family.
